Whether depicted as a tool, a symbol, or a weapon, hands have consistently stood as a crucial channel for artistic expression, surpassing mere anatomical representation to articulate a diverse array of emotions and narratives.

Nevertheless, aspiring artists often find themselves intimidated by the complexity of figurative elements, particularly hands. Our 3-day workshop is designed to help you overcome this barrier by guiding you through the process of modelling convincing and expressive hands in clay.

The workshop focuses on anatomy, proportions, and the gesture of a hand, along with advanced principles of shape design and modelling. Drawing from the knowledge presented during lectures and demonstrations, and using yourself as a reference, you will create a life-size hand in clay with a dynamic gesture of your choice.
